Briefing

Bitcoin’s price recently dipped below $90,000, signaling a significant market reset. This move indicates a shift in investor behavior, with long-term holders ceasing their selling activity. The key profitability indicator, the SOPR ratio, has fallen to 1.35, marking its lowest point since early 2024, which suggests that speculative excess has been purged from the market.

Analysis

This market reset occurred because long-term Bitcoin holders, those who have held their assets for over 155 days, have stopped selling. Think of it like a crowded theater where everyone is trying to exit at once; eventually, the rush subsides, and those who remain are content to stay. The SOPR ratio, which measures the profitability of spent Bitcoin, dropped to a two-year low, confirming that the intense profit-taking and distribution phase by these long-term holders has concluded. This purge of speculative “foam” has set the stage for a new market equilibrium, removing the immediate selling pressure that often accompanies extended rallies.

Outlook

In the coming days and weeks, watch for Bitcoin to establish a new support level above this reset point. The cessation of selling pressure from long-term holders suggests a potential stabilization. However, without a clear signal for an immediate bullish restart, the market might consolidate as it finds its new equilibrium. Keep an eye on trading volumes and further on-chain data to confirm if this market reset truly marks the end of the distribution phase and the beginning of renewed accumulation.
